Abstract

The utility model provides a baking finish dysmorphism show cupboard, relates to a showcase, includes: a box body; an upper cover arranged at the upper end of the box body; an upper cover handle arranged on the upper cover; the notebook computer support plate component is arranged on the outer wall of the box body; each notebook computer support plate component is connected with the box body through a hinge and a pneumatic support rod; the plug wire holes are arranged on the box body and are in one-to-one correspondence with the notebook computer support plate components; the cable supporting plate, the fan, the power strip and the partition plate are arranged in the box body; the cable supporting plate is positioned at the upper end of the fan; a plurality of baffles are uniformly distributed on the cable support plate. The utility model is simple in operation, safe convenient, convenient wiring, radiating effect are good, can effectively support and demonstrate notebook computer.

Detailed Description
The present invention will be described in further detail with reference to the accompanying drawings.
As shown in fig. 1 to 6, the utility model discloses a baking finish special-shaped display cabinet mainly includes:
the multifunctional notebook computer storage cabinet comprises a box body 1, a bottom plate 2, universal wheels 3, an article storage cabinet 4, a coded lock 5, hinges 6, a notebook computer support plate component 7, a wire inserting hole 8, a sliding groove 9, a limiting plate 10, an upper cover 11, an upper cover handle 12, a cable supporting plate 13, a fan 14, a wire inserting row 15, a partition plate 16 and a pneumatic supporting rod 17.
Wherein, the bottom of the box body 1 is provided with a universal wheel 3, and the movement of the whole display cabinet can be realized through the universal wheel 3.
The lower part of the box body 1 is provided with an article storage cabinet 4, and each article storage cabinet 4 is provided with a coded lock 5. The number of the article storage cabinets 4 can be set as required, and in this embodiment, the number of the article storage cabinets 4 is four, and the number of the corresponding coded locks 5 is also four.
In this embodiment, the outer surface of the box body 1 is prepared by a baking finish process.
The base plate 2 is disposed in the case 1 while the base plate 2 is located above the article storage bin 4.
Two rows of notebook computer support plate components 7 for placing notebook computers are arranged on the front surface of the box body 1. The number of notebook computer inlet assemblies 7 in each row is multiple, and in the present embodiment, the number of notebook computer inlet assemblies 7 in each row is five. The edge of the rear end of each notebook computer support plate component 7 is connected with the front side of the box body 1 through two hinges 6, and meanwhile, the two sides of each notebook computer support plate component 7 are connected with the front side of the box body 1 through pneumatic supporting rods 17 respectively. The notebook computer support plate component 7 can be folded under the combined action of the pneumatic support rod 17 and the hinge 6, and transportation is facilitated.
As shown in FIG. 2, the notebook computer board assembly 7 mainly includes a board 701, side plates 702, and a front plate 703, wherein the two side plates 702 are respectively installed on two sides of the board 701, and the front plate 703 is installed at the front end of the board 701. The side plate 702 and the front plate 703 are both perpendicular to the support plate 701. The support plate 701 is provided with a plurality of heat dissipation holes which are uniformly distributed.
A plurality of wire inserting holes 8 are formed in the box body 1, wherein the wire inserting holes 8 correspond to the notebook computer supporting plate components 7 one by one, namely, one wire inserting hole 8 is formed above each notebook computer supporting plate component 7.
The box body 1 is provided with a plurality of sliding grooves 9, wherein the sliding grooves 9 and the notebook computer supporting plate components 7 are in one-to-one correspondence, namely, the sliding grooves 9 are arranged above the notebook computer supporting plate components 7.
A limit plate 10 is mounted in each chute 9. As shown in fig. 4, two strip-shaped sliding grooves 901 are respectively disposed on two sides of the sliding groove 9. As shown in fig. 5 and 6, the limiting plate 10 mainly includes: spacing mainboard 1001, slider 1002, a slider 1003. The limiting main board 1001 is of an L-shaped structure, a sliding block 1002 is arranged at the end of the long edge of the L-shaped structure, and two sliding blocks 1003 are arranged at two ends of the sliding block 1002 respectively. The sliding blocks 1002 are installed in the sliding grooves 9, and the two sliding blocks 1003 are installed in one-to-one correspondence with the two strip-shaped sliding grooves 901. The stopper plate 10 is movable up and down in the chute 9.
An upper cover 11 is arranged at the upper end of the box body 1, and an upper cover handle 12 is arranged on the upper cover 11.
As shown in fig. 3, a cable support plate 13, a fan 14, a power strip 15, and a partition 16 are provided inside the case 1. At least one fan 14 is provided, and in the present embodiment, the number of the fans 14 is two, and two fans 14 are provided at the upper end of the base plate 2. The cable support plate 13 is arranged at the upper end of the fan 14, and a plurality of heat dissipation holes are uniformly distributed in the cable support plate 13. A plurality of uniformly distributed partition boards 16 are arranged on the cable support plate 13, and the partition boards 16 are arranged perpendicular to the cable support plate 13. The cable support plate 13 is divided into different cells by the partition plate 16, and a power adapter and a power line of the notebook computer can be placed in each cell. The socket 15 is provided at an inner upper end of the cabinet 1. The number of the socket 15 may be set as desired. In the present embodiment, the number of the socket 15 is two.
When the baking varnish special-shaped display cabinet is used, the notebook computer support plate component 7 is opened, a notebook computer is placed on the support plate 701 in the notebook computer support plate component 7, the side plate 702 and the front plate 703 are used for limiting and placing the notebook computer to fall off, and meanwhile, the limiting plate 10 is slid to the upper edge of the screen of the notebook computer along the chute 9 for limiting; the upper cover 11 is opened, the corresponding power adapter and power line of the notebook computer are placed on the cable support plate 13 inside the box body 1 and respectively placed in the small lattices divided by the partition plate 16, then the power plug of the notebook computer and the power plug of the fan 14 are inserted into the power strip 15, the power strip 15 is externally connected with a 220V power supply, the connector of the notebook computer of the power adapter penetrates through the wire insertion hole 8 to be inserted into the corresponding interface of the notebook computer, and then the notebook computer is opened for display. After the exhibition is finished, the notebook computer, the power adapter and the like can be placed in the article storage cabinet 4 and locked by the coded lock 5 to prevent theft.
